RULES AND INSTRUCTIONS
- THIS ADMIT CARD MUST BE BROUGHT TO THE EXAMINATION CENTRE WITHOUT WHICH NO CANDIDATE WILL BE ALLOWED ENTRY TO THE EXAMINATION CENTRE.
- This Admit Card does not constitute an offer of admission.
- You are provisionally permitted to appear for Written Examination as per the schedule given on Page-1.
- Gate of the examination centre shall be closed 30 minutes before the commencement of examination after which no candidate shall be permitted entry under any circumstances.
- You must bring any valid Original photo ID proof for verification, such as (i) Voter ID Card, (ii) PAN Card, (iii) Driving License, (iv) Photo ID issued by any government organization or recognized educational institution, (v) Passport (vi) Aadhar Card, etc. to the examination centre. Candidates without valid original ID proof will not be permitted for the examination.
- You must bring with you Ball Point Pen (black/blue) for taking the examination.
- Note that the items listed below are strictly NOT allowed inside the examination centre campus:
- Mobile Phone, Bag, Handbag, Water Bottle, Papers, notes, books, calculator, electronic gadgets, correction marker/white fluid, etc.
- It is clarified that there shall be no arrangements at the Examination Centres for keeping the aforesaid items. If any item is lost, the Centre or National Council of Hotel Management & Catering Technology will not be responsible for such loss. Candidates are, therefore, advised either not to carry the aforementioned items with them on the date of the examination or to make their own arrangements for keeping such items in safe custody at their sole risk.
- Any candidate found using or to be in possession of such unauthorized material or indulging in copying or adopting unfair means is liable to be summarily disqualified
- Possessing any electronic device such as mobile phone by the candidate inside the examination center campus before completion of the examination will be considered as attempting to take or send the Question Booklet in full or in part outside the examination room. Appropriate civil and/or criminal proceedings will be initiated against any candidate taking or attempting to take or send the Question Booklet in full or in part outside the examination room besides cancellation of his/her candidature.
- Duration of the Paper will be 180 minutes. There will be 25% Negative Marking for every wrong answer and incorrectly marked answer.
- DO NOT carry the question booklet or any part thereof outside the examination hall before completion of examination. Doing so is a punishable offence.
- No candidate will be allowed to leave the examination room before the end of examination.
- The candidate should ensure that he/she fulfills all the eligibility conditions for admission to the examination. The admission at all stages of the examination for which he/she is admitted will be purely provisional subject to his/her satisfying the eligibility conditions. If on verification at any time before or after the Written examination or subsequent stages of examination for which he/she is admitted it is found that the candidate does not fulfill any of the eligibility conditions, his/her candidature shall stand cancelled without any notice or further reference.
- Request for change of examination centre and date will not be entertained.
- Any attempt to influence will lead to disqualification of candidature.
- Discrepancies, if any, regarding your particulars in this admit card can be emailed at nchmct@applyadmission.net at least 7 days prior to the Written Examination.
INSTRUCTIONS FOR FILLING IN THE OMR ANSWER SHEET
Answer sheets are scanned by machine to compute the scores. Accuracy in scoring is dependent on the candidates marking their answer sheets properly. Therefore, accurate scoring is dependent on your strict adherence to the following instructions: - Every question has four answer options. Mark the answer option number chosen by darkening the corresponding oval on the answer sheet USING BALL POINT PEN (BLUE/BLACK) ONLY.
- Shade only one oval. Shading of more than one oval or improper shading will be treated as wrong answer leading to scoring of negative marks for which the candidate would be solely liable. No communication in this regard shall be entertained.
- The correct method of shading the oval has been indicated in "Important Instructions" on Side-1 of the Answer Sheet and that must be strictly followed.
- Do not tear, bend or mutilate the Answer Sheet.
